Toggle navigation
首页
文学
流行
文化
生活
经营
科技
【海量资料】
搜索
《Arduino开发实战指南》PDF电子书下载
电信下载地址
联通下载地址
移动下载地址
网盘下载地址
其它下载地址
【海量资料】
《Arduino开发实战指南》内容简介
程晨 / 机械工业出版社 / 2012-3 / 59.00元 -
本书主要通过了解,学习,使用Arduino开源模块,让读者在实战过程中学习并掌握基于AVR8位单片机的项目开发技巧。
在2011年举行的Google I/O开发者大会上,Google发布了基于Arduino的Android Open Accessory标准和ADK工具,这使得大家对Arduino的前景十分看好。Phillip Torrone大胆地预测Google将用Android+Arduino的形式掀起自己的“Kinect模式”浪潮。目前,国内关注Arduino的人越来越多,但介绍Arduino的书籍却很少。笔者由于工作的关系,接触Arduino较早,所以希望通过自己的努力让更多的人了解Arduino,在近一年的时间里,通过不断学习、查阅Arduino相关知识,终于完成了书稿的撰写工作。但在书稿完成之后,心中却一直忐忑不安,Arduino是一个介于软件与硬件之间的产品,系统性不是很强,加上笔者水平有限,拙著中一定存在不少的缺点与漏洞,为此,笔者先为书中的不足之处致以真诚的歉意,同时诚挚地欢迎广大读者提出宝贵的意见并不吝赐教。
本书的内容及面向的读者
Arduino是一个注重实际动手操作的产品,所以本书以实际应用为纽带将各个章节联系起来。本书共9章,首先介绍Arduino的一些基础知识,接着针对具体应用介绍了一些扩展板以及Arduino扩展库,最后应用之前的内容完成了具有视频监控功能的履带车、遥控机械臂以及双足机器人的制作。
因为Arduino本身具有简单易用的特点,所以本书面向的读者是所有有兴趣使用Arduino进行项目开发的人。
当然,根据读者的情况不同,本书的阅读方式也不同。
如果读者是一个之前没有进行过单片机开发也没有进行过软件开发的人,现在想使用Arduino来实现自己的一些想法,那么首先要阅读本书的前两章,了解一些简单的编程思想以及程序结构,接下来阅读第3章的目录,了解Arduino都有什么基本函数,具体内容可以先不用看,当你之后使用这些函数遇到问题时再回过头来看一看相应的函数说明。然后将Arduino接到你的电脑上,翻开第4章,根据书中的内容,边学习边实践,4.5节可以跳过不看。第5~7章介绍了Arduino周边的资源,以便帮助你尽快地实现想法,这3章的内容也可以采用跳跃式的阅读方式。第8、9章会告诉你前3章的内容是如何结合起来的,建议按照书中的内容至少动手完成一个项目的制作。
如果读者之前进行过AVR单片机的开发,想了解Arduino一些底层的知识,那么第2章的知识就可以跳过了,在简单地翻阅第3章的内容后,直接进入第4章,把Arduino连到电脑上实践一下,再回过头阅读第3章中关于Arduino的基本函数,结合自身已有的AVR单片机的知识了解Arduino底层的工作机制。需要说明的是,这里需要读者自己花一些精力,可能还需要学习一些C++方面的知识。第5章对Arduino硬件原理进行了详细介绍,若读者之前学习过,这一章可以选择性学习。第6章介绍的是Arduino的扩展库,如果读者也想开发一些Arduino扩展板,并以库的形式提供扩展板的软件资源,那么建议先学习最后一节,再从6.1节开始学习,深入地了解这些扩展库是如何与Arduino结合在一起的。至于剩下几章的内容,如果用开发单片机的思路来完成也是不难的,所以阅读的重点是看看如何用Arduino的思路进行项目的制作。
如果读者之前是做纯电脑软件开发工作的,即使用C++非常熟练,那么在阅读完第1章后,可以直接跳到第4章,感受一下Arduino给纯软件开发人员带来的那种完成硬件制作的感觉,然后仔细阅读第5章,看看目前都有哪些扩展板可以为自己所用,控制电机、控制液晶之类的,硬件知识哪怕我们不用,也还是要了解一些的。接下来,对于第6章,可以仔细阅读一下与硬件关系不太大的扩展库以及如何创建自己的库,在今后底层硬件库不断丰富完善的情况下,开发一些注重应用、与底层关系不是太紧密的库时,这就是我们的用武之地。第7~9章的内容会告诉我们前面的知识是如何结合起来的—用纯软件的思路,同样建议按照书中的内容至少动手完成一个项目的制作,做纯软件开发工作的人开发硬件也是很容易的。
致谢
首先要感谢本书的策划张国强先生,是他对Arduino的关注促成了本书的出版,同时在笔者撰写书稿时他也对本书提出了宝贵的写作建议,并对书稿进行了仔细审阅。
其次要感谢让我了解Arduino的庄明波先生,他不但在技术上给予了我很多的指导,同时也无私地提供了大量的Arduino扩展板的资料以及实物,供我在Arduino的程序调试中使用,同时与我共同探讨技术上遇到的问题。
最后要感谢现在正捧着这本书的您,感谢您肯花费时间和精力阅读本书,由于时间有
同类热门电子书下载
更多
人机界面设计
人机交互
数字化生存
给设计师的研究指南:方法与实践
新媒体艺术
IDEA物語
写给大家看的设计书
Axure RP 8.0 入门宝典
The Resonant Interface
Learning Quartz Composer, Book Component
信息架构设计
以用户为中心的软件设计
人本X互動設計
众妙之门-抓住访客心理的网页设计
Kinect人机交互开发实践
Information Graphics
Adobe Flash Catalyst CS5交互设计大师之路
基于Arduino的趣味电子制作
Beyond Interaction ―メディアアートのためのopenFrameworksプログラミング入門
Smart Things
电子书分类
小说
文学
外国文学
经典
中国文学
随笔
日本文学
散文
村上春树
诗歌
童话
名著
儿童文学
古典文学
余华
王小波
当代文学
杂文
张爱玲
外国名著
鲁迅
钱钟书
诗词
茨威格
米兰·昆德拉
杜拉斯
港台
漫画
推理
绘本
悬疑
东野圭吾
科幻
青春
言情
推理小说
奇幻
日本漫画
武侠
耽美
科幻小说
网络小说
三毛
韩寒
亦舒
阿加莎·克里斯蒂
金庸
穿越
安妮宝贝
轻小说
魔幻
郭敬明
青春文学
几米
J.K.罗琳
幾米
张小娴
校园
古龙
高木直子
沧月
余秋雨
王朔
历史
心理学
哲学
社会学
传记
文化
艺术
社会
政治
设计
政治学
宗教
电影
建筑
中国历史
数学
回忆录
思想
人物传记
艺术史
国学
人文
音乐
绘画
戏剧
西方哲学
近代史
二战
军事
佛教
考古
自由主义
美术
爱情
成长
生活
心理
女性
旅行
励志
教育
摄影
职场
美食
游记
灵修
健康
情感
人际关系
两性
养生
手工
家居
自助游
经济学
管理
经济
商业
金融
投资
营销
理财
创业
股票
广告
企业史
策划
科普
互联网
科学
编程
交互设计
算法
用户体验
科技
web
交互
通信
UE
神经网络
UCD
程序
Copyright © 2023 by
米奇吧 - PDF电子书下载
All Rights Reserved.
豫ICP备14005038号-2